#6079f2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6079f2 is composed of 37.6% red, 47.5%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.3% cyan, 50%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 229.7 degrees, a saturation of 84.9% and a lightness of 66.3%. #6079f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0f2ff with #0000e5.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#6079f2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000104 is the darkest color, while #f1f3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6079f2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a9a9a9 is the less saturated color, while #5975f9 is the most saturated one.
